前台:
var idArray = [];
$("section td input[type='checkbox']:checked").each(function(){
idArray.push($(this).attr("name"));
})
$.ajax({
url : context + "/matches/release",
type : 'post',
data: {'idArray':idArray},
traditional:true,
success:function(data){
}
})
注意: traditional:true 要加,否则http传的参数会变为 Array[]=111&&Array[]=222
后台:
@RequestMapping(value = "/release", method = RequestMethod.POST)
@ResponseBody
public boolean releaseMatches( Integer[] idArray)
throws IOException {
return true;
}
本文介绍了一个简单的前后端交互示例,展示了如何从前端收集已选中的复选框名称,并通过AJAX请求将这些数据发送到后端。需要注意的是,在发送数组时要确保参数格式正确,避免因格式错误导致的数据解析问题。
6280

被折叠的 条评论
为什么被折叠?



